  • Patent number: 4184761
    Abstract: An exposure control device for the shutter of a camera wherein an opening member opens the aperture of the shutter to start exposure, a closing member closes the aperture to complete exposure, an opening hook and a closing hook retain at a charged position the opening member and the closing member, respectively. A control member is released by shutter release operation to control the exposure time by shutter release operation to control the exposure time and to successively release said opening member and said closing member. A governor delays the motion of said control member in proportion to desired exposure times. An interlocking lever is adjustable to a first range where it is actuated by the movement of the control member to push the closing hook and to a second range where it is actuated by the movement of the opening member to push the closing hook. An adjusting lever supports the interlocking lever operable within the first and second ranges.

  • Patent number: 4145132
    Abstract: A camera shutter mechanism including a shutter opening member mounted for pivoting about a first axis between a closed position corresponding to a closed shutter and an open position corresponding to an open shutter, and a shutter closing member mounted for pivoting about a second axis between an open position corresponding to an open shutter and a closed position corresponding to a closed shutter. A movable driving member includes a coupling mechanism for releasably coupling the driving member to the shutter opening member to permit moving the shutter opening member by moving the driving member, and for releasing the shutter opening member from the driving member when the shutter opening member is moved from the open to the closed position. A first spring biases the driving member to move the shutter opening member from the closed to the opened position to initiate exposure, and a second spring biases the shutter closing member to move from the opened to the closed position to terminate exposure.

  • Patent number: 4143957
    Abstract: A camera shutter includes a pair of spaced apart base plates supporting the various shutter components. At least one of the base plates is formed entirely of synthetic resin material which is electrically insulative and which possesses lubricating properties. The synthetic resin base plate has a set of tubular portions extending toward and connected to the other base plate and also has a set of shafts turnably supporting some of the shutter components, such as the control lever and control cam. The synthetic resin base plate also includes a hollow winding frame about which is wound a coil and in which is slidably inserted an armature to form an electromagnet for use in controlling the shutter operation. The use of a synthetic resin base plate dispenses with the necessity of separate lubrication and enables formation of a smaller shutter.

  • Patent number: 4139085
    Abstract: A clutch of the single-plate dry-disc type is structured to include annular friction facings secured to opposite surfaces of a supporting plate of a clutch plate and a plurality of recesses or shallow grooves are defined in the surface of one of the annular friction facings. The shallow grooves extend from the inner periphery of the one annular friction facing and terminate short of the outer periphery thereof.Accelerated air streams are introduced from the exterior through the fly wheel into the plurality of grooves so as to aid in separation of the friction facing of the clutch plate from the engaging surface of a fly wheel as a result of a hydrodynamic force created by the air streams. Furthermore, slots are defined in the surface of the friction facing in addition to the grooves so as to provide discharge passages for powder which has been produced due to wear or attrition of the friction facings.

  • Patent number: 4110772
    Abstract: A camera shutter has a set of shutter blades movable from an initial closed position in which the blades close an exposure aperture to an open position opening the exposure aperture and then to a final closed position again closing the exposure aperture. Opening and closing driving members sequentially drive the shutter blades from the initial closed position to the open position and then to the final closed position to effect an exposure. A cocking mechanism coacts with the opening and closing driving members for cocking the camera shutter to move the shutter blades from the final closed position to the initial closed position in readiness for taking an exposure. A rebound preventing device is provided for preventing rebound of the shutter blades after reaching their final closed positions and comprises a notched pin on a lever of the cocking mechanism engageable with a hook portion of the closing drive member to thereby prevent rebounding of the shutter blades.

  • Patent number: 4110767
    Abstract: In a single lens reflex camera, the shutter base plate is provided with a recess in which the reflecting mirror is mounted. This permits the mirror to be closer to the film plane and hence permits the imaging plane, prism and viewing lens of the view finder to be closer to the optical axis of the camera lens, thus reducing the overall size of the camera.

  • Patent number: 4091401
    Abstract: The operating mechanism for a camera shutter comprises a pivoted actuating member for opening the shutter and a pivoted actuating member for closing the shutter. A driving spring for biasing each of the actuating members in actuating direction has one end acting on the respective actuating member and the other end supported by a ratchet wheel which is coaxial with respective actuating member so that the spring bias can be varied by rotary movement of the ratchet wheel. Spring finger portions of a spring plate which overlies the shutter operating mechanism engage the ratchet wheels to retain them in selected angular positions against the reaction forces of the respective springs. Portions of the spring plate support the spring fingers intermediate their attachment to the spring plate and their free ends engaging the respective ratchet wheels.
